Steel drive piers and helical piers are usually an engineer's recommended remedy for these conditions. These piers penetrate through unstable grounds down to a more consistent ground layer that's sufficient strength to support the construction. These piercing systems provide a deep foundation that can now be lifted off of to regain an sufficient altitude. In the case of homes with basements, expansive clay soils which have been over saturated with water can cause hydrostatic pressure on walls. This newly imposed pressure can cause wall bowing and concrete cracking. In extreme cases, catastrophic failure can happen from these wall stresses.

The genuine basement sealing is often a multi-step procedure by itself. It normally starts with plugging any cracks visible from the inside of the foundation and basement walls. A nice coating of waterproofing paint (NOT damp-proofing, but waterproofing) is the second part of the process. Then you definitely polish it off by finding all the holes (windows, ducts, conduits, etc.) between the inside of the basement and the exterior, and caulk or otherwise seal around them.

There are many possible causes of water damage to your basement. The most common cause is the possibility of having land that has a flat or negative slope. This will cause water to pool and gather against your foundation. Another possibility is that the contractor of your house didn't properly waterproof your foundation.
